What Are the Best Tires for Reducing Road Noise?

The best tires for reducing road noise typically include touring tires, noise-reducing tires, and premium all-season tires.

  1. Touring tires
  2. Noise-reducing tires
  3. Premium all-season tires
  4. Studless winter tires
  5. Different tread patterns
  6. Tire brand variations

The effectiveness of a tire in minimizing road noise often varies by type and brand.

  1. Touring Tires:
    Touring tires excel in comfort and quietness. These tires have specialized tread patterns designed to offer a smooth ride while minimizing noise levels. For example, the Michelin Defender T+H and the Bridgestone Turanza QuietTrack are well-regarded for their quiet operation. According to a 2022 report by Tire Rack, touring tires can reduce noise by up to 5 decibels compared to standard tires, creating a more pleasant driving experience.

  2. Noise-Reducing Tires:
    Noise-reducing tires incorporate advanced technology to dampen sound waves. This technology often involves the use of foam inserts within the tire that absorbs vibrations. For instance, the Goodyear Assurance WeatherReady features this type of technology. A study by the Rubber Manufacturers Association in 2021 notes that these tires can lower road noise by up to 50% in certain conditions, making them suitable for luxury vehicles.

  3. Premium All-Season Tires:
    Premium all-season tires provide versatility and can be quieter than standard all-season tires. These tires are manufactured with advanced rubber compounds and optimized tread designs that aim for reduced noise levels. The Continental PureContact LS is an example that balances performance and quietness. According to Tire Rack reviews, many users report a significant reduction in cabin noise compared to budget options.

  4. Studless Winter Tires:
    Studless winter tires may also offer reduced noise due to their softer rubber compounds and unique tread designs. These factors contribute to a quieter ride in cold weather. The Bridgestone Blizzak WS90 is an example of a studless tire that provides reduced noise. Research conducted by the American Society of Mechanical Engineers in 2020 documented that these tires can be quieter than traditional studded options.

  5. Different Tread Patterns:
    Tread patterns play a significant role in tire noise. Tires with asymmetric or symmetric tread patterns can help disperse sound waves more effectively. Tires designed with a variable pitch tread pattern help to reduce harmonics, contributing to a quieter experience. According to a survey by Car and Driver in 2021, consumers reported a noticeable difference in noise levels based on tread design.

  6. Tire Brand Variations:
    Different tire brands offer various models specifically designed for reduced road noise. Brands such as Michelin, Continental, and Pirelli are known for their engineering focus on quiet tires. Tire reviews consistently highlight these brands for their innovative approaches to noise reduction. A 2023 study in the Journal of Tire Technology revealed that brand consistency can significantly affect noise levels, indicating that investing in reputable brands can yield better results.

How Does Tire Construction Affect Noise Levels?

Tire construction significantly affects noise levels. Different components and design features influence how tires sound on the road. First, tread design plays a crucial role. Tires with closed or minimized grooves typically produce less noise. Open tread patterns often generate more noise because they trap air.

Next, the rubber compound used in tire construction influences noise. Softer rubber tends to absorb sound better than harder compounds, resulting in quieter performance. Additionally, a multi-layer construction can reduce vibrations. This helps limit the noise transmitted into the vehicle cabin.

Moreover, tire shape affects contact with the road. Tires with rounded edges create smoother interactions, reducing noise. Flat or square edges may cause more noise due to increased road contact.

Lastly, the overall tire size and width can also impact noise. Wider tires often have more significant road contact, which can lead to increased noise. Conversely, narrower tires may produce less noise due to less surface area in contact with the road.

Tire construction is crucial in determining tire noise levels. Factors such as tread design, rubber compound, layer construction, tire shape, and size all contribute to the overall noise experience.

What Considerations Should You Keep in Mind When Selecting Tires for Reduced Road Noise?

When selecting tires for reduced road noise, consider factors such as tire design, tread pattern, rubber compounds, and tire pressure.

  1. Tire design
  2. Tread pattern
  3. Rubber compounds
  4. Tire pressure
  5. Tire size
  6. Noise rating
  7. Vehicle type

The above considerations highlight various aspects to address when aiming to minimize road noise.

  1. Tire Design:
    Tire design refers to the overall shape and structure of the tire. A well-designed tire typically incorporates noise-absorbing materials and features that reduce vibrations. According to a study by the Rubber Manufacturers Association in 2019, tires with a specific design can lower road noise levels by 6 to 10 decibels compared to standard designs. For instance, tires with an asymmetric design often perform better in noise reduction.

  2. Tread Pattern:
    The tread pattern is the arrangement of grooves and patterns on the tire surface. Features like closed tread designs or less aggressive patterns can contribute to quieter rides. A study published in the journal “Applied Acoustics” in 2020 indicated that tires with more continuous surfaces generate less noise when rolling over different road types. For example, luxury vehicle tires generally have optimized tread patterns for noise reduction.

  3. Rubber Compounds:
    Rubber compounds refer to the materials used in tire manufacturing. Softer compounds tend to reduce road noise as they are more effective in dampening vibrations. According to a 2021 research study by the Institute of Tire Research, tires made from advanced polymer blends can reduce noise emissions significantly. Brands that specifically market “quiet” tires often rely on unique rubber formulations to achieve sound dampening.

  4. Tire Pressure:
    Tire pressure affects the contact of the tire with the road surface. Properly inflated tires maintain optimal performance and reduce noise. The National Highway Traffic Safety Administration states that under-inflated tires can increase rolling resistance, leading to amplified road noise. Regularly checking and adjusting tire pressure can lead to quieter rides.

  5. Tire Size:
    Tire size influences both performance and noise levels. Generally, larger tires can produce more road noise. A 2018 study by the Society of Automotive Engineers found that tires with a smaller overall diameter typically result in lesser noise generation. Choosing the correct size can help achieve a balance between comfort and sound control.

  6. Noise Rating:
    The noise rating indicates the acoustic performance level of a tire. It is often expressed in decibels, with lower values signifying quieter tires. According to the European Union tire labeling regulations, tires are rated from silent (one wave) to very noisy (three waves). Selecting tires with better noise ratings can greatly impact the driving experience concerning sound.

  7. Vehicle Type:
    The type of vehicle can dictate the level of road noise produced. For instance, sedans may benefit more from quiet tires compared to SUVs due to weight distribution and drive dynamics. A report by Consumer Reports in 2021 emphasized that vehicle characteristics could make certain tires more suitable for noise reduction based on specific driving needs and preferences. Selecting tires that are designed for specific vehicle types can enhance overall comfort.
